Encoding and Ciphering
The course is not on the list Without time-table
Code | Completion | Credits | Range | Language |
---|---|---|---|---|
128ENCI | ZK | 4 | 3P | English |
- Course guarantor:
- Tomáš Vaníček
- Lecturer:
- Tomáš Vaníček
- Tutor:
- Supervisor:
- Department of Applied Informatics
- Synopsis:
-
Caesat cipher, monoalphabetic cipher, vigenere cipher, enigma, Hill cipher, linear encoding, Hamming encoding, Ellis cipher, DH principe, RSA, PGP, AES
- Requirements:
-
To come later
- Syllabus of lectures:
-
Caesar cipher
Monoalphabetic cipher
Polyalphabetic cipher, Kasiski method
Enigma
Linear codes
Hamming code
Feistel codes
DES, AES
DH principe
RSA
PGP
Quantum cryptography
- Syllabus of tutorials:
-
No exercises
- Study Objective:
-
To understand principes of classical and modern ciphering methods.
- Study materials:
-
N.Singh: Book of codes and ciphers
- Note:
- Further information:
- Není
- No time-table has been prepared for this course
- The course is a part of the following study plans: